well if you look at the results of the Sand Bass tournament held in August with 33 anglers fishing they didn't catch enough to feed the group. They were allowed to catch 10 with the top 5 to determine their weight.

I believe they had to add frozen catfish into the mix to get enough fish to feed everyone.

When the "usual" began with fish busting on little shad everyone said sand bass. Not the case. Baby bass are every where eating the shad. I have not caught a sand bass this year. And little sand bass should be every where because of all of the rain we had in the spring. They only spawn when the creeks are running.
